Trent earned a total of $18 by selling 6 cups of lemonade. After selling a total of 12 cups of lemonade, how much money will Tre

nt have made in all?
Mathematics
1 answer:
zhannawk [14.2K]3 years ago
7 0

Answer:$36


Step-by-step explanation:

He has sold 6 and made $18 6x2=12 2x18=36
